获取163邮箱的邮件 并下载附件

老师要求让获取邮箱邮件内容,发件人、收件人、发送时间等等。转存到excel里面。并下载邮件带的附件,通过网上搜集资料,整理出例如以下代码,仅仅是实现功能。代码并未优化。

使用的时候仅仅须要填写自己邮箱账号password就可以(须要源代码的能够留下邮箱)

以下贴出代码,
